Cà Gialla Yellow House is a standalone apartment of approximately 50 square meters located on the ground floor, nestled in the peaceful hills between Bonassola and Levanto. The bright and practical rooms open directly onto a private garden, creating a relaxing atmosphere just minutes away from the sea.

The accommodation includes a double bedroom, a spacious living room with a double sofa bed, a walk-in closet, a private bathroom equipped with a shower and bidet, and a convenient kitchenette furnished with all the essentials for self-catering. The fireplace adds a cozy touch during cooler seasons, while independent heating ensures comfort throughout the year.

Outside, guests can enjoy a small garden furnished with a table, chairs, an umbrella, and sun loungers, perfect for unwinding outdoors surrounded by greenery. Additional amenities include a private parking space, free Wi-Fi, and a TV with international satellite channels.

The location is especially favored by those who enjoy alternating days at the beach with hiking and walking. Bonassola is about 1.5 km away and can also be reached via a scenic panoramic trail. During the summer months, a shuttle service connects the area to the beach. However, having a car remains the most convenient way to explore the surroundings comfortably.

Cà Gialla is situated on the Punta del Carlino promontory, one of the most scenic spots on the Ligurian coast, nestled between the bays of Bonassola and Levanto. Its elevated location offers stunning views of the sea and Mediterranean scrubland, providing a peaceful and natural setting, perfect for those looking to escape the daily hustle while still being close to seaside towns.

From here, you can reach Bonassola by traveling along a road of about one and a half kilometers or by choosing one of the paths crossing the promontory. Hiking enthusiasts will find numerous trails connecting Bonassola, Levanto, and the Montaretto district, passing through woods, olive groves, and panoramic viewpoints overlooking the Ligurian Sea.

Levanto, the gateway to the Cinque Terre, is easily accessible and serves as an excellent starting point for excursions by train, boat, or along the spectacular coastal trails. Bonassola, with its beach, promenade, and charming historic center, offers a more intimate and relaxed atmosphere, ideal for strolling through narrow streets, local shops, and traditional restaurants.

The area is also crossed by the famous cycling and pedestrian path created on the old railway line, one of the most picturesque routes on the Riviera, linking Levanto, Bonassola, and Framura through illuminated tunnels and natural terraces overlooking the sea.
